Parrots (Psittacidae)
Papuan King-parrot (Alisterus chloropterus) - HBW 4, p. 396
French: Perruche à ailes vertes
German: Papuasittich
Spanish: Papagayo Papú
Other common names: Green-winged King-parrot
Taxonomy: Aprosmictus chloropterus E. P. Ramsay, 1879, Goldie River, New Guinea.
Genus has occasionally been lumped with Aprosmictus. Forms a superspecies with A. amboinensis. Three subspecies recognized.
Subspecies and Distribution:
- moszkowskii (Reichenow, 1911) - N New Guinea.
- callopterus (D'Albertis & Salvadori, 1879) - C New Guinea from Weyland Mts to R Fly.
- chloropterus (E. P. Ramsay, 1879) - E New Guinea.
